Education and Experience Requirements
High School Diploma or GED required. 1 year related structural assembly experience. Experience working with Solumina and Smarteam preferred.. One year experience credit considered for graduates of Savannah Tech Aircraft Structures Technical Certificate Program.
Position Purpose : In a team oriented work environment, under moderate supervision, performs a variety of structural assembly operations in a production department.Job Description
Principle Duties and Responsibilities: Essential Functions:- Perform assembly and fitting of detail parts and structures and varied drilling and riveting operations; ensures parts/assembly meet FAA requirements, customer specifications, and Gulfstream standard of quality .
- Rivet structural assemblies and parts, including sheetmetal parts, using all tools required. to do the job (e.g. portable riveting guns, pneumatic guns, pneumatic drills, counter sinks, rivet shavers, files, reamers, rivets) .
- Read work orders, blueprints, lofts, sketches, and operation sheets to determine sequence of operations, type size and hole pattern for rivets.
- Check all work and ensure a defective free assembly prior to final inspection .
- Maintain and use all logs and records (e.g. MIR sheets, DMTs, Crabs, PCOs). Use resource planning system to enter daily labor against correct Work Order and Item numbers .
- Align and assemble parts to be riveted using jigs, holding fixtures, pins, clamps, and fasteners .
- Maintain a neat and orderly work area, supports the company 5S Program and complies with all safety regulations .
